What is Singapore Airlines Asset Turnover?

Asset Turnover measures how quickly a company turns over its asset through sales. It is calculated as Revenue divided by Total Assets. Singapore Airlines's Revenue for the three months ended in Mar. 2024 was S$4,768 Mil. Singapore Airlines's Total Assets for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2024 was S$43,799 Mil. Therefore, Singapore Airlines's Asset Turnover for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2024 was 0.11.

Asset Turnover is linked to ROE % through Du Pont Formula. Singapore Airlines's annualized ROE % for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2024 was 14.41%. It is also linked to ROA % through Du Pont Formula. Singapore Airlines's annualized ROA % for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2024 was 5.25%.

Singapore Airlines Asset Turnover Calculation

Asset Turnover measures how quickly a company turns over its asset through sales.

Singapore Airlines's Asset Turnover for the fiscal year that ended in Mar. 2024 is calculated as

Asset Turnover
=Revenue/Average Total Assets
=Revenue (A: Mar. 2024 )/( (Total Assets (A: Mar. 2023 )+Total Assets (A: Mar. 2024 ))/ count )
=19012.7/( (49101.2+44264.7)/ 2 )
=19012.7/46682.95
=0.41

Singapore Airlines's Asset Turnover for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2024 is calculated as

Asset Turnover
=Revenue/Average Total Assets
=Revenue (Q: Mar. 2024 )/( (Total Assets (Q: Dec. 2023 )+Total Assets (Q: Mar. 2024 ))/ count )
=4768.4/( (43333.9+44264.7)/ 2 )
=4768.4/43799.3
=0.11

Companies with low profit margins tend to have high Asset Turnover, while those with high profit margins have low Asset Turnover. Companies in the retail industry tend to have a very high turnover ratio.

Be Aware

In the article Joining The Dark Side: Pirates, Spies and Short Sellers, James Montier reported that In their US sample covering the period 1968-2003, Cooper et al find that firms with low asset growth outperformed firms with high asset growth by an astounding 20% p.a. equally weighted. Even when controlling for market, size and style, low asset growth firms outperformed high asset growth firms by 13% p.a. Therefore a company with fast asset growth may underperform.

Therefore, it is a good sign if a company's Asset Turnover is consistent or even increases. If a company's asset grows faster than sales, its Asset Turnover will decline, which can be a warning sign.

Singapore Airlines is Singapore's flagship carrier and one of the region's largest airlines in revenue and carrying capacity. The company's hub is Changi Airport, providing regional and cross-continental passenger and cargo services destined to or transit through Singapore. The company operates under dual brands: the premium carrier, SIA, coupled with its wholly owned subsidiary, and the low-cost regional carrier Scoot. It also owns stakes in SATs and SIA Engineering.
